diff --git a/js/src/components/Event/TagInput.vue b/js/src/components/Event/TagInput.vue
index bf63f2272..076ac3066 100644
--- a/js/src/components/Event/TagInput.vue
+++ b/js/src/components/Event/TagInput.vue
@@ -39,6 +39,8 @@ export default {
                 :allow-new="true"
                 :field="path"
                 icon="label"
+                maxlength="20"
+                maxtags="10"
                 :placeholder="$t('Eg: Stockholm, Dance, Chess…')"
                 @typing="getFilteredTags"
         >